legally immigrating into the US without a lot of money to grease the wheels so to speak would probably take you a few years. If you are hired by an American company that wants you to work locally you will get a work Visa not a green card that has a limited duration and needs to be renewed but as long as you are working there should be no problem. However if you lose the job you have a pretty narrow window to get another one or lose the Visa.

I have had a couple of friends who were here on work Visas one of which became a citizen while here working.
